Emmanouil Karalis Achieves Historic Jump, Matching National Record

Emmanouil Karalis achieved a historic jump of 6.17 meters in the pole vault, equaling the national record and securing a place at the top of global athletics. This performance places him in the same category as Mondo Duplantis, the world record holder. The jump took place in Paiania, with the support of his family, and marks a significant moment in the athlete's career, who has overcome many difficulties. The embrace with his father, also an athlete, was a particularly moving moment, symbolizing the support and love that helped him reach this level. He received phone calls from Sergey Bubka and comments from Duplantis.
